Heads up, support folks — this PR changes how the Examgate proctoring queue assigns students to live reviewers. Before, everyone landed in one global queue, so a flagged exam in one region could stall reviews everywhere. Now we shard by region and escalate stale items to a shared overflow pool. You'll see shorter waits in most cases, but escalated items may bounce between reviewers once. The timers and thresholds driving escalation are tunable, and the values shipping in this release are listed below.

tuning table, yajog-yahof:
BUDGETS = {
    "lamvan": 303,
    "wenox": 460,
    "fenvan": 525,
}

Subject: Handover — Tilecast prefetcher release duties

Hi all,

I'm handing off release duties for the Tilecast map-tile prefetcher while I'm out. The v2.4 build is staged; it adds smarter prefetch radius scaling near city centers. Run the cache-warm smoke test before promoting, and watch the eviction metrics for an hour after. The artifact still needs to be signed before the CDN push — use the key below:

rollout seal: bky4_x7Gc

## Releases

Heads up: 3.2.1 fixes the rounding drift in Lunafex currency conversion. We now round half-even at the final step only, so penny mismatches in multi-hop conversions are gone. Before cutting the release, run the regression suite against the synthetic ledger fixtures. Tag, build, and sign the artifacts with the release key below.

deploy key for bagag-kawef: bky13_evWojgvVA8Pp4

/*
 * Cold-start tuning for the Farrow dispatch handlers.
 * Support team: if customers report slow first requests after a deploy,
 * it is almost always cold starts on the Nimbrel runtime, not the database.
 * We keep a warm pool and ping handlers on a schedule; raising the pool
 * size costs money, lowering it costs latency. Do not change values here
 * without checking the dashboard trend for at least one full business day.
 * The constants governing warm-pool size and ping cadence follow.
 */

tuning table, faduf-baduf:
PRIORITIES = {
    "ulavan": 191,
    "silys": 750,
    "goriel": 238,
    "kelmir": 66,
    "wendor": 432,
}